Pete played in two basketball games. He scored 4 fewer points in the second game than he scored in the first. He scored 12 point

s in the second game. How many points did he score in the first game?
Mathematics
2 answers:
kiruha [24]2 years ago
8 0

Answer:

16

Step-by-step explanation:

12+4=16

12 being the number he scored in the second game, and four being the ones he added to said score in the first game.
